12. Changes to This Document

The following changes have been made to this document:

Table 12.1 Migration Guide Changes in/after 7.3.0

Version

Date

Change

1

May 15, 2024

Created 6.1.2-to-7.3.0 upgrade path

2

October 1, 2024

Added 7.3.0-to-7.4.0 upgrade path

3

October 11, 2024

  • Simplied Regressions for improved readability. Regressions are now documented only in the release in which they were introduced

  • Removed CORE-11896 because it was introduced in a patch release. Regressions introduced in four-digit patch releases are no longer documented in this Migration Guide; they are documented in the relevant release’s release notes once they are fixed

4

December 27, 2024

Enhanced explanations of year 2038 support in Section 6.2.1.2.3 and Section 6.2.2.5.4

5

April 9, 2025

Added 7.4.0-to-7.5.0 upgrade path

6

October 30, 2025

  • Added 7.5.0-to-7.6.0 upgrade path

  • Added more regressions found since 6.0.0

7

November 20, 2025

  • Added 7.3.0-to-7.3.1 upgrade path

  • Removed upgrade steps from 7.4.0-7.6.0 sections that were already in the 7.3.0-to-7.3.1 upgrade path

  • Removed product-specific instructions for upgrading Connext Micro from the 5.3.1-to-6.0.0 path. These instructions can now be found in the Connext Micro Migration Guide. Note that any upgrade information related to Connext Micro’s compatibility with the Connext suite is still documented in this guide.

Table 12.2 Migration Guide Changes in 6.1.2

Version

Date

Change

1

December 1, 2022

Created

2

December 15, 2022

Table 12.3 Migration Guide Changes in 6.1.1

Version

Date

Change

1

March 2, 2022

Created

Table 12.4 Migration Guide Changes in 6.1.0

Version

Date

Change

1

April 26, 2021

Created

2

May 24, 2021

3

July 9, 2021

4

July 28, 2021

Added CORE-11742 in Regressions in 6.1.0

5

September 13, 2021

6

February 28, 2022

7

March 2, 2022

Added Linking static Linux or QNX libraries with object files built with -fPIC will fail

Table 12.5 Migration Guide Changes in 6.0.1

Version

Date

Change

1

December 10, 2019

Created

2

February 21, 2020

Section 9.2.4 used to say that Secure WAN Transport 6.0.1 is not API-compatible with “versions earlier than OpenSSL 1.1.0.” It should have said, “with OpenSSL 1.1.0 or below.” That has been corrected.

3

March 2, 2020

Clarified that upgrading to 6.0.0 or 6.0.1 (including upgrading from 6.0.0 to 6.0.1) requires regeneration and recompilation, in Section 1.2.

4

May 26, 2020

RTI Prototyper no longer works in 6.0.1; see Section 11.9.4.

Table 12.6 Migration Guide Changes in 6.0.0

Version

Date

Change

1

March 18, 2019

Created

2

April 10, 2019

3

May 3, 2019

Added XML compatibility (regression) issue in Section 11.10.1.18

4

May 10, 2019

5

May 20, 2019

6

June 21, 2019

7

July 2, 2019

  • Added important recommendations for using the new QoS Profile multiple inheritance feature, in Section 10.1.5.1

  • Added XML compatibility (regression) issue in Section 11.10.1.18.2

8

August 7, 2019

Added a workaround to the regression described in Section 11.10.1.18.2

9

September 25, 2019

Added information about a crash (regression) in Section 11.10.1.21

10

September 26, 2019

Discovery does not complete, and there is no error (regression), in Section 11.10.1.19

11

October 25, 2019

Added the following Routing Service issues (regressions):

Added two Recording Service issues (regressions) in Section 11.10.6

12

November 22, 2019

Added the following (regressions):

Clarified timeout error during write() operation, in Section 10.1.2.1

Moved all regressions into one new section: Section 11.10

13

February 21, 2020

Added the following (regressions):

14

March 4, 2020

Added RTPS interoperability information, in Section 10.1.1.1.